Buprenorphine is utilized in a type of treatment referred to as medication assisted treatment (MAT) for people in Locust Grove who are dependent to opoids such as prescription pain killers or heroin. Unlike Methadone which is also used in medication assisted treatment but is only allowed to be administered in strictly controlled clinics, Buprenorphine may be prescribed and administered in doctor's offices which provides easier access to this type of opiate treatment.

When Buprenorphine is used in recovery it can help individuals who are going through the intense cravings and withdrawal symptoms brought on by opiate withdrawal. Buprenorphine helps to control and diminish these withdrawal symptoms so that the person can focus and stay off drugs as well as not engage in typical drug seeking behaviors. When the medication assisted treatment idea was first conceived and implemented, it wasn't intended to be a stand-alone activity but rather only part of a "whole-patient" approach that would ideally incorporate actual therapy practices for opioid dependency and addiction recovery. Buprenorphine use would only be one part of a larger comprehensive recovery plan.

Buprenorphine might also produce the euphoric "high" associated with other opiates so it can be misused. This is another reason it is crucial for anyone thinking about medication assisted treatment as the treatment plan they want to take, to also receive help from substance abuse counselors to integrate other methods of behavioral therapy and life repair programs into their plan of rehabilitation so that they feel confident about recovery.
